Design Notes for Embroidery Professionals
If you're planning to use the Herding Dog Clipart Collection in your next embroidery project, here are a few practical tips:
- Test on scrap fabric: Always do a test run before committing to a final piece, especially if you're working with dark fabric or thin fabric.
- Check thread color contrast: Make sure the colors work well with your chosen fabric and background.
- Review stitch density: Avoid overloading dense stitch areas that might cause puckering or distortion.
- Confirm hoop size: Ensure the design fits comfortably within your hoop to avoid stretching or misalignment.
- Inspect small details: Look closely at the icons and lines to ensure they remain clear after stitching.
- Test in black and white mockups: This helps you see how the design will look on different backgrounds.
- Use proper stabilizer: Especially important when working with curved surfaces like caps or layered garments.
- Check licensing: Before selling finished items or digital embroidery files, confirm whether the license allows commercial use.
